Police have released surveillance footage of a group of suspects tailing a Dominos pizza deliveryman in a bid to catch the alleged pizza thieves.
The incident occurred on June 19 at 8:35 p.m.on 8th street between South and Lombard streets.
Surveillance video shows the group of six attackers tailing the Dominos pizza deliveryman as he walks down the block around the corner from a nearby Dominospizza shop at 7th and South streets.
As the deliveryman turned onto Lombard Street, he was jumped from behind.
Surveillance video shows the attacks running away carrying a pizza bag.
The deliveryman sustained minor lacerations to his elbow, according to police.
